The most crucial factors of the indoor environment performances in the museum are the staffs and visitors perception towards sick building syndrome and indoor environment quality. Besides, one of the methods used to investigate the satisfaction level on the indoor environmental performance is Post Occupancy Evaluation. The respondents are the visitors and staffs of the National Museum and Perak Museum and these museums are selected as the case study in this study.
